Output 95d0fe6130eee2f60c4f7b4eb1cd0a6d3aa61ee83b69787979e7caceebe99ae4:1

value
43912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8933784d19b7b2059cbfb73c2a4568996bab542d OP_EQUAL
address
3ECUA1ypRguHARXDRgtzLHyrWS7Yxg3g8T
transaction
95d0fe6130eee2f60c4f7b4eb1cd0a6d3aa61ee83b69787979e7caceebe99ae4
confirmations
174141
spent
true